#711358 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#711358 is composed of 44.3% red, 7.5%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 83.2% magenta, 22.1%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 316 degrees, a saturation of 71.2% and a lightness of 25.9%. #711358 color hex could be obtained by blending #e226b0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

Shades and Tints of #711358

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c020a is the darkest color, while #fefafd is the lightest one.

Tones of #711358

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#434143 is the less saturated color, while #80045f is the most saturated one.
